论文标题

2N维规范系统和应用

2N-Dimensional Canonical Systems and Applications

论文作者

Acharya, Keshav Raj, Ludu, Andrei

论文摘要

我们研究了2N维规范系统,并讨论其基本解决方案的某些特性。然后,我们讨论周期性规范系统的Floquet理论,并观察其解决方案的渐近行为。还讨论了系统的一些重要物理应用:周期性哈密顿系统的线性稳定性,依赖位置的有效质量,伪周期性非线性水浪和狄拉克系统。

We study the 2N-dimensional canonical systems and discuss some properties of its fundamental solution. We then discuss the Floquet theory of periodic canonical systems and observe the asymptotic behavior of its solution. Some important physical applications of the systems are also discussed: linear stability of periodic Hamiltonian systems, position-dependent effective mass, pseudo-periodic nonlinear water waves, and Dirac systems.
